# Heads up: this client talks to Thumbforge, our internal thumbnail queue.
# Jobs land in the "render-fast" lane unless the source image is over 20MB,
# in which case they fall to "render-slow" and can sit for a while.
# If the queue backs up, check worker pool size before paging anyone.
# The client authenticates with the key below.

gateway credential: kto23_LX9A4ys6i4nzHtpOLNLodKK

Handover — Cage visit, Dunmarle data centre. For new starters: the quarterly hardware audit in Cage 7 runs tomorrow morning. Sign in at the security lodge, collect the escort lanyard, and wait for the duty technician before entering the cold aisle. Do not unplug anything without a signed change slip. Leave the audit clipboard on the hook when finished. The cage keypad takes the code below.

staff pass of kawip-hawef = bdg-QLP-2

This release changes several defaults in the Inkmill printer-spooler microservice. Job retention drops from 30 days to 7, the retry backoff is now exponential rather than fixed, and duplex rendering is enabled by default for supported queues. Reviewers should note that operators who relied on the old retention window must pin it explicitly; the migration script only warns, it does not preserve prior values. For clarity, the new default configuration shipped with this release appears below.

deployment values, bahof-badug:
[rusix]
team = zorok
access_code = ac_641cbe
owner = ulair.tamius
host = rusix.torvasoft.local
port = 5672
peer = ulaix.sivrelworks.internal
salt = 1df570ed
pin = 6327

## Releases

TrailNote's offline mode ships as a separate bundle so field crews in the Verdance basin can sync surveys without connectivity. Release manager duties: cut the tag, run the offline fixture suite, and confirm the sync-queue migration applies cleanly against a cold database. Offline bundles are distributed through the Halloway relay, which rejects anything unsigned, so signing is not optional even for betas. Once the bundle builds, sign it before upload using the deploy key that follows.

release key, hadug-kawef: bky13_mPGeFZeR1GZ1G